Option 1.2. Use a Spread Range Source
A range can include multiple passes.
The blocks are:
Begin Spread Range Block Module marks the start of a multiple-pass Spread Range Block Module in the routing or output logic module. | |
End Spread Range Block Module marks the end of a multiple-pass Spread Range Block Module that starts with a Begin Spread Range Block Module. |
If no items or no unweighted items remain after an evaluation, these blocks can expand the range and provide multiple passes through the module.
When you add these blocks, the:
- Number of items included in the evaluation set is incremented
- Expanded set is re-evaluated by a second pass by the Spread Range Block Module logic.
- Evaluation repeats multiple times, up to the number of passes you specify, until at least one unweighted item remains.
Do not put a count block inside the spread range logic.
